Beachfront Property
21.75 x 16.5 watercolor on Italia 140 lb soft press paper. This is a crop from a horizontal beach seascape with major elements rearranged, such as removing the picket fence that went straight across, parallel to the bottom, a compositional no-no! The scene had brush, grass, and branches throughout so those were edited and omitted. Now the viewer can walk in and go towards the next dune, the water, or the houses distant upper left. All I drew with pencil were the houses and large foliage upper right; all else is done with a brush. Sure wish I was there on this beachfront property.
